WebHis victim, Charles Augustus Lindbergh, was the 20-month-old son of famed aviator Charles Lindbergh and his wife Anne Morrow Lindbergh. The case was a complex one. It involved a series of ransom notes ranging from $50,000 upwards to $100,000, received over a period of several weeks. A payment of $50,000 was eventually paid. The number of ransom note significantly affected the outcome of the case since they were able to gather evidence from each note. It led them to find more evidence and an outline for comparison. They were able to compare the writing on the notes, which eventually solved the case.
